Holographic multiplexing metasurface with twisted diffractive neural network
Meta-disk utilizes structural multiplexing to significantly enhance optical holographic storage capacity, enabling the storage of numerous high-fidelity images. The technology offers potential applications in optical storage and optical computing.
It unveils an inventive volumetric storage paradigm by harnessing the properties of light, such as its wavelength, polarization state, orbital angular momentum, and incident angle, along with versatile optical materials to store data.
